Why Choose a Career as a CNA?
Becoming a CNA is not only financially rewarding but also fulfilling. Here are some compelling reasons why this path can be right for you:
- high Demand: The healthcare sector is rapidly growing,and CNAs are in constant demand.
- Short Training Duration: CNA training programs typically last between 4 to 12 weeks.
- Make a difference: CNAs provide essential care and support to patients, frequently enough becoming their primary source of comfort.
- Flexible Hours: Many facilities offer flexible shifts, allowing a healthy work-life balance.

Program Details
Each of these programs provides a comprehensive education covering essential aspects such as:
- Basic patient care
- Safety and emergency procedures
- Dialog skills
- Medical ethics
- Patient mobility assistance
Benefits of CNA Certification
Obtaining your CNA certification opens several doors in the healthcare industry. Here are just a few benefits:
Career Opportunities
As a certified nursing assistant, you can work in various settings, including:
- Hospitals
- Long-term care facilities
- Assisted living centers
- Home health agencies
Pathway to Advancement
Many CNAs choose to further their education and advance to roles such as:
- Registered Nurse (RN)
- Nurse Practitioner (NP)
- Healthcare Administrative Roles
Practical Tips for Aspiring CNAs
Here are some practical tips to help you succeed in your journey toward becoming a CNA:
- Research Programs: Identify programs that best meet your needs based on location, duration, and cost.
- Prepare for classes: Brush up on basic medical terminology and care procedures.
- get Hands-On Experience: Volunteer at healthcare facilities to gain experience and enhance your resume.
- Network: Connect with professionals in the field to learn about potential job opportunities.
- Study hard: Focus on both the theoretical and practical elements of the CNA curriculum.
